What is a synonym for the word dispersed?

Some common synonyms of disperse are dispel, dissipate, and scatter. While all these words mean "to cause to separate or break up," disperse implies a wider separation and a complete breaking up of a mass or group.

What does disperse actually mean?

Disperse is to spread out people or things, making them move in different directions. Imagine yourself standing on a basketball court holding a cup packed tight with marbles. If you turn it over, the marbles will disperse across the floor, moving away from you in all directions. Another word for this is scatter.

What is the verb form of dispersed?

1[intransitive, transitive] to move apart and go away in different directions; to make someone or something do this The fog began to disperse. The crowd dispersed quickly. disperse somebody/something Police dispersed the protesters with tear gas.

How do you use dispersed in a sentence?

Police dispersed the crowd that had gathered. Outside the church, the congregation shook hands with the vicar and began to disperse. Debris from the aircraft was dispersed over a large area.
